Ninnie 08-05-2009 08:24 AM

The center is completed now!I added one more row of 16" squares and it now measures 48" by 64". I am going to add a 6" border on all sides , so It will, when done measure 60" by 76". which I think will be fine for a lap quilt for the den.
Still thinking about designs for the border, but have a few written down, so still need help!

Each 16" block has what I consider pinning points, some quilters don't pin, but I am a ig believer in pinning.
